**Q: How do I unlock the PickWhiz optimizer config if the admin session expires mid-release?**

Happens to everyone. PickWhiz locks the routing config after 15 idle minutes, and the normal unlock needs the Rackline ops console, which is usually down during deploy windows. For release cuts, just use the emergency recovery flow instead. Enter the passphrase below when prompted:

vault phrase of faduf-bajep = tamius-rusox-holok-kasdor-rusdor-druius-giliel-ulaox-zoriel

## Breaker Env Vars (quick ref for sync)

Heads up: the Moorhen API breaker reads three env vars now. `MH_BREAKER_FAILS=10` and `MH_BREAKER_COOLDOWN=45` cover trip behavior. The half-open probe also needs the upstream auth secret in the env file, so drop that assignment in as the next line.

sealed setting: RELAY_SECRET5=82864

Changelog — GateCount v3.8 (weekly eng sync). We renamed TURNSTILE_POLL_RATE to GATE_SAMPLE_INTERVAL_MS across the Ledgeview Stadium counter service to clarify that the value is milliseconds, not seconds. The old name is still read with a deprecation warning until v4.0, so staged rollouts at Ferrow Park won't break. Update your local env files when convenient. Remember the sampler also needs its upstream ingest credential, so add the following line directly beneath the interval setting.

env line for fafof-fahag: LEDGER_TOKEN5=f8790

**Q: Why does the waveform preview in Chirplet sometimes show up blank?**

Usually the render worker at Tonefall hasn't finished crunching the audio yet — give it thirty seconds and refresh. If it's still blank, the preview cache probably needs a reset from the admin panel. To unlock the cache admin account, you'll need the recovery passphrase. It's right here:

strongbox words: gilok-druion-briath-wendor-briion-prawyn-fenion-oliir-casdor-holius-briius-gilath-gilael-pelys

Ticket: Staging env misconfigured for Siftgate bloom filter

The bloom layer in front of the Pellet KV store is rejecting all lookups in staging because the env file was copied from the dev template without credentials. False-positive tuning values are fine; only the auth line is missing. To unblock the weekly demo, the Pellet admission secret must be set on the following line.

env line for yaguf-fajop: LEDGER_TOKEN13=fb08984397349